I found that the DynamicSky setting for Advanced sky had been hardcoded to false. I fixed this, but Imbaczek noticed that it uses some CPU.
Most people don't see the sky while playing, so it is a shame to waste CPU on it for no reason.
Do you guys think it would be OK to only update the dynamic sky if it is currently in camera view?
